JC Penney: New pricing, new brands, liberal returns and Ellen

The wait is over. JC Penney’s big news has been announced. The chain has introduced a new pricing strategy, a new logo, new brands and a liberal return policy.

Called Fair and Square, the pricing strategy includes three types of prices: Everyday, Regular prices;  Month-Long Values, even better prices; and Best Prices, the store’s  lowest prices, which always happen on the 1st and 3rd Fridays of every month.

 This pricing schedule will take the place of relentless sales, coupons, rebates and retail gimmicks. The chain will offer 12 promotional events each year, on a monthly calendar. Each month will include even better values on the things customers are looking to buy during the month, according to the company.

JC Penney also plans to re-invent the stores with a series of 80 to 100 brand shops. New brands include Martha Stewart and l’amour nanette lepore.

The new JC Penney brand identity includes a new logo and a familiar face, Ellen DeGeneres, who will be the pitch woman for the company.  And the new return policy is simple — any item, anytime, anywhere.

The shopping experience begins Feb.1 with the new logo and pricing strategy. Then, beginning in August, the chain will start a month-by-month, shop-by-shop strategy to update all stores with new merchandise and presentation.
